In MY opinion, acronyms for Meat's better known tracks, like AFL / BOOH are fine but it took a good scour of iTunes for me to figure out what you meant by WAL...however I got used to it in the end. I guess if you don't mind the scouring of CD cases or iTunes / hunting for the acronyms thread [which I can never find...and why is the word acronym so long btw?] / or admitting in the thread you haven't a clue what people are talking about then it's not so bad and you'll learn eventually, but I agree obscure acronyms can get a bit frustrating sometimes. People will always talk in acronyms tho - I remember at one point having to ask people what btw, imo, pmsl, afk, lol, lmao and so on and so forth meant...and those aren't things specific to the Meat forum. If most of you started talking to me about your work I probably wouldn't understand you either as you probably use a whole host of acronyms you don't even realise you use. I work in Community Safety and recently emailed a friend saying I had witnessed an 'rta' - a term in common use in my workplace. Didn't realise until she asked me that 'rta' meant nothing and certainly not 'road traffic accident' in my friend's world. Actually thinking about this...acronyms make posts shorter....so no, I don't like them |
